A lot of electrical power is definitely wasted when fridges and freezers, both heavy users of electricity anyway, are not working efficiently. You can easily save up to 60% on energy when you get a new one, in comparison with those from longer than ten years ago. Always keeping the temperature of the fridge at 37F, in conjunction with 0F for the freezer, will save on electricity, while keeping food at the correct temperature. You can easily reduce how often the motor has to run by frequently cleaning the condenser, which will save on electricity.

The ingredients needed to prepare Flapjacks ala Maaike:
- Take 80 grams of butter.
- Get 60 grams of sugar.
- Provide 1 tbsp of cinnamon.
- Take 1 small of apple.
- Use 15 grams of honey.
- Get 120 grams of rolled oats.
Steps to make Flapjacks ala Maaike:
- Preheat oven to 160°C.
- Place the honey, sugar and butter in a saucepan. Heat gently until the butter has melted into the sugar and honey, stir well..
- Cut the apple into cubes.
- Put the oats and the apple with the mixture in the saucepan. Stir to coat the oats and apples..
- Pour the mixture into a prepared tin..
- Bake in the oven for 25 minutes or until golden brown. Remove from the oven while the flapjack is still soft. They will harden once cool..
- Place the tin on a wire cooling rack and cut the flapjack into squares. Leave in the tin until completely cold..
These flapjacks are delicious in a packed lunch or as a grab-and-go breakfast. You can also pour some melted dark chocolate over the cooked flapjacks and then leave them to set before eating.
